The most common sort of refractive eye surgery is laser-assisted in situ keratomileusis (LASIK). During LASIK surgical procedure, an ophthalmologist improves the cornea making use of a laser to boost vision.
visit the next document consist of photorefractive keratectomy (PRK), which includes removing part of the surface layer of the cornea; implantable contact lenses (ICLs), which replace the existing lens with a synthetic one; and conductive keratoplasty (CK), which uses radio waves to reduce collagen fibers in order to improve the cornea. Each procedure has its own set of risks and benefits that must be thought about when deciding which sort of eye surgery is best for you.

In terms of advantages, the key benefit is enhanced vision. Eye surgical procedure can correct numerous visual impairments like nearsightedness and astigmatism, aiding you see much more clearly and delight in tasks such as reviewing or driving without restorative lenses. Additionally, it can also reduce or get rid of the need for glasses or call lenses completely.
On the other hand, there are a few dangers associated with eye surgical treatment that should not be ignored. Problems may consist of infection, completely dry eyes, light sensitivity and even irreversible visual impairment; nonetheless, these occur in only a handful of instances. Along with these prospective adverse effects, there might additionally be discomfort and pain throughout recovery which might last for numerous days after the procedure.
